Covenant Baseball Splits Twin Bill with Emory

 The Covenant Scots split a doubleheader against the Emory Eagles, in an NCAA Division III baseball game on Saturday, March 4, 2023.  

In the first game of the twin bill, Scots junior pitcher Bryce Bollinger (Portland, Tenn.) worked his way out of a bases loaded jam in the top of the first without allowing a run, setting the tone for the rest of the game. 

The next couple of innings were relatively uneventful offensively – with only one Scot and one Eagle reaching base – in what turned out to be the beginning of a pitcher's duel between Covenant's Bollinger and Emory's Joey Bock.

The Scots threatened in the bottom of the fourth with singles by junior shortstop Zeke Gilbert (Douglasville, Ga.) and sophomore first baseman Chris Savage (Burleson, Texas), but failed to score. Bollinger retired the Eagles, 3-up 3-down, on seven pitches in the top of the fifth, and the pitcher's duel continued in the sixth frame as both pitchers retired the side, 3-up 3-down, each with two strikeouts in the inning.
